Raigarh to Get a Grand Library and Study Center Under NTPC Lara CSR Initiative

Raigarh Municipal Corporation and NTPC Sign MoA for Nalanda Campus Construction Worth INR 42.56 Crore

Chhattisgarh Government has approved the construction of 22 Nalanda Campuses across the state, reiterating the importance of fostering a knowledge-based society.

Raipur, Chhattisgarh (India CSR): In a significant step towards building an educational hub in Raigarh, a Memorandum of Agreement (MoA) worth INR 42.56 crore was signed between Raigarh Municipal Corporation and NTPC Lara under CSR for the construction of the Nalanda Campus. The agreement was signed in the presence of Chhattisgarh’s Finance Minister, Mr. OP Chaudhary, who highlighted the importance of the Nalanda Campus in shaping Raigarh as a beacon of knowledge and education.

Transforming Raigarh into an Educational Hub

Finance Minister Mr. OP Chaudhary emphasized that the upcoming Nalanda Campus would be a milestone in transforming Raigarh into an education hub. He further stated that the knowledge-based society envisioned through this project would lay the foundation for future generations.

“The Nalanda Campus will be instrumental in making Raigarh a hub for education. It will be a milestone in the development of our new generation,” said Mr. Chaudhary during the signing ceremony.

State-of-the-Art Library Facilities

The proposed Nalanda Campus will include a state-of-the-art library that will provide a 24/7 study zone, with the capacity to accommodate over 500 students simultaneously. This library will be well-equipped with a collection of over 25,000 books, providing students with access to an extensive range of international e-books.

Additionally, the campus will feature three conference halls and a cafeteria, making it conducive for group studies and discussions. There will be dedicated resources for the preparation of competitive exams such as Civil Services, medical and engineering entrance exams, and the Common Law Admission Test (CLAT). For younger students, there will be a separate kid’s study zone, providing books and study materials as per the syllabus. Furthermore, seminars on career guidance will be organized regularly to help students navigate their educational journey.

Empowering the Future Generation

Speaking at the event, Mr. Chaudhary remarked, “It is our dream to see Raigarh achieve new heights of development, where our upcoming generation plays an active role.” He highlighted the collaboration with NTPC for building the Nalanda Campus, stating that the tender process has been approved.

Emphasizing the need for a knowledge-based society, Mr. Chaudhary said, “The future will be driven by knowledge. From a $266 billion economy in 1991, India has grown into a $3.7 trillion economy in 2024. As the economy strengthens, every section of society benefits, but those who stay updated with knowledge reap the maximum rewards.”

Creating an Ecosystem for Learning

Reflecting on the success of the Nalanda Campus in Raipur, Mr. Chaudhary pointed out that it has become a center where students from across the city come to study, and many of them have reached the interview stages of UPSC and State PSC exams. The library also draws aspirants of other competitive exams, creating a robust ecosystem for education.

He further mentioned that the government has approved the construction of 22 Nalanda Campuses across the state, reiterating the importance of fostering a knowledge-based society.

The Origin of the Nalanda Campus Idea

Sharing the inspiration behind establishing the Nalanda Campus, Mr. Chaudhary recalled his experience when he went to Bhilai for further studies after completing his 12th grade. While Bhilai had an excellent environment for preparing for medical and engineering entrance exams, there was a lack of resources for Civil Services preparation. Even large bookstores did not have sufficient books for Civil Services, which forced him to travel to Delhi to find the required study material.

“In Raipur, even good books were not easily available, so I went to Delhi, where I found all the books in a single depot. This made me realize the stark difference—the lack of the right books and environment meant that people from our region were not being selected for Civil Services,” he explained.

Mr. Chaudhary further elaborated that it was this experience that inspired him to establish the Nalanda Campus in Raipur when he became the Collector, providing young aspirants the resources and environment needed for success. “Today, hundreds of young people are advancing on the path to success by benefiting from this facility,” he added.

A Lesson from Personal Experience

Mr. Chaudhary also shared a personal anecdote about how he had not been selected for the Navodaya competitive exam, mainly due to a lack of proper guidance and preparation. He emphasized that having faced such challenges, he felt compelled to find solutions for others when he was in a position of authority.

Dantewada’s Nanhe Parinde Project

Mr. Chaudhary mentioned another project close to his heart—the Nanhe Parinde project in Dantewada. The project was aimed at selecting children from remote, impoverished, and Naxal-affected families and preparing them for the 5th-grade competitive exams for admission into Navodaya and Sainik Schools. Today, many of these children are doing well in their lives, reflecting the success of such initiatives.

The Nalanda Campus in Raigarh, supported by NTPC, is expected to not only provide world-class infrastructure but also foster an environment of learning and intellectual growth, helping thousands of students across the region to pursue their academic dreams.
